Articles of 安装

showmount -e nfs_server_hostname不显示客户端的所有可用安装,但是为什么?

NFS_Server是一个DataDomain客户端是RHEL 7.3 我运行一个下面的命令来显示从NFS_server为我的客户端系统共享的可用NFS,但是,我没有看到所有可用的共享挂载。 # showmount -e nfs_server_hostname /test myclientsIP # showmount -e nfs_server_IP /test myclientsIP 就我而言,我想要一个没有显示在上述命令结果中的特定坐标。 仍然作为DataDomain(在我们这里是一个NFS_Server)人告诉我挂载一个特定的共享,即使你没有在上面的showmount命令的输出中看到它。 令我惊讶的是它已经登上了,所以我再次跑到命令的上方,仍然没有显示在列表中。 但是当我检查下面命令的输出时,我感到惊讶。 # df -h . . . NFS_Server_IP:/test_Rep /mnt 我想知道它发生的原因,还有没有其他的命令列出隐藏的挂载点? 先谢谢了,并且对差的英语道歉,如果这不是这个问题的正确网站。

我可以将一个新的磁盘挂载到具有完全访问权限的另一个磁盘的子目录吗?

服务器的磁盘(或RAID 1中的2个磁盘)正在运行(96%)。 我想添加一个新的SSD(不是RAID的一部分)。 我不明白的是如何或在何处安装它,所以我可以在现有的结构中无缝地使用它。 如何在Linux下将子目录挂载到硬盘上? 不会让我变得更聪明,即使这可能是我正在寻找的东西。 我有类似/var/www/vhosts/example.com/httpdocs/images/dirA 。 因为web服务器(Apache和nginx)能立即访问新磁盘上的文件对我来说很重要,所以我想我必须将它挂载到/var/www/vhosts/example.com/httpdocs/某个地方,将不会以有限的方式结束。 那么我可以创build/var/www/vhosts/example.com/httpdocs/images/dirB并在那里安装新的磁盘? 它会以任何方式影响RAID? 或者,build议将其安装在“外部”,比如/newDiskX ,然后将符号链接/newDiskX到/var/www/vhosts/example.com/httpdocs/images/dirB ? 我从https://unix.stackexchange.com/questions/198542/what-happens-when-you-mount-over-an-existing-folder-with-contents了解到的是我无法直接安装它到/var/www/vhosts/example.com/httpdocs/images/dirA没有任何复杂性,或实际上获得更多的空间。 我的问题是,我只有“一枪”,我自己做不到; 我必须告诉我的主机安装新的磁盘,以及在哪里挂载/绑定/链接它。 编辑: 为了使其可视化,这里是当前/计划的结构: / ├── A/ (existing on old disk) | ├── B/ (existing on old disk, access point for Apache etc.) | | ├── C/ (existing on old disk) | | | └── file.tmp (existing on old disk) […]

在KVM中安装Pfsense

我试图在KVM中安装PFsense,并且因为没有find可安装的发行版而一直不能运行。 以下错误是什么意思? Fetching volume XML failed: Storage volume not found: no storage vol with matching path 这里是我正在运行的安装命令: virt-install –debug –name=Firewall –memory=4096 –vcpus=2 –location=/opt/OS_Images/pfSense-CE-2.4.1-RELEASE-amd64.iso –disk=/var/lib/libvirt/images/Firewall.qcow2,device=disk,bus=virtio,size=10 –network bridge:virbr0 –os-type=linux –nographics –extra-args='console=tty0 console=ttyS0,115200n8 serial' 这是从安装尝试完整的 – debugging: [root@s119918 OS_Images]# virt-install –debug –name=Firewall –memory=4096 –vcpus=2 –location=/opt/OS_Images/pfSense-CE-2.4.1-RELEASE-amd64.iso –disk=/var/lib/libvirt/images/Firewall.qcow2,device=disk,bus=virtio,size=10 –network bridge:virbr0 –os-type=linux –nographics –extra-args='console=tty0 console=ttyS0,115200n8 serial' [Wed, 08 Nov 2017 15:34:16 […]

如何在Xen虚拟机上安装CDROM?

如何在Xen虚拟机上安装CDROM? 我试图添加到磁盘arrays没有成功 'phy:/dev/cdrom,xvdb:cdrom,r'

安装SQL Server客户端工具的问题

我们正努力在Windows 2008 Standard上安装64位的SQL Server 2005 Standard。 之前做过这个没有问题。 这一次,我们在安装客户端工具时遇到错误: 在安装向导过程中出现了意外的故障 链接ID 20476,消息ID 50000 事件日志中没有错误。 任何人有什么想法可能是错的?

Windows 2008升级挂在死亡的黑屏上; 无法从媒体启动

周末有人试图在我们的一台机器上升级Windows Server 2003到2008。 不知道发生了什么事情,但它不起作用,现在当绿色的小酒吧启动后,屏幕变黑,有一个白色的光标,什么也没有发生。 如果我以SafeMode启动,我会遇到某种“无法在SafeMode中完成安装,请重新启动”的错误,所以在这里没有做任何事情。 我想我会尝试一个全新的安装,但我不能得到ISO或可启动USB闪存驱动器的光盘工作。 我已经testing了另一台机器上的CD和闪存驱动器,他们工作正常。 在这台机器上,如果我试图从启动顺序启动,它说没有find可启动的媒体,如果我尝试从启动菜单直接启动,USB驱动器方法卡住闪烁的光标,没有任何反应,而CD将带我到“安全模式启动Windows”提示符。 我试图启动一个Linux光盘,以排除CD驱动器,工作正常。 有任何想法吗?

vSphere安装最佳实践

任何人都可以详细说明或提供有关从ESX 3.5 / VC 2.5升级到vSphere的最佳实践的文档,包括任何陷阱?

如何使用linux作为安装服务器在Sun Blade 1500上networking安装Solaris 10?

我想在安装有CDROM阅读器的Sun Blade 1500上安装Solaris 10(仅适用于DVD介质)。 我想尝试一个使用Linux的networking安装服务器的networking安装。 我find的所有文档都是特定于solaris的(它假设有一个solaris安装服务器) 任何人都可以给我任何build议吗?

在运行shell脚本时,如何防止覆盖或截断文件?

如果应用程序正在运行其使用的共享库之一被写入或截断,则应用程序将崩溃。 移动文件或使用'rm'批量删除文件不会导致崩溃,因为操作系统(Solaris在这种情况下,但我认为这在Linux和其他* nix上也是如此)足够聪明,不会删除与该文件,而任何进程打开。 我有一个执行共享库安装的shell脚本。 有时,可能会用它来重新安装已经安装的共享库的版本,而无需首先卸载。 因为应用程序可能正在使用已经安装的共享库,所以重要的是脚本足够聪明,可以将文件打包或移动(例如,当我们知道没有应用程序时,cron可以清空的“已删除”文件夹将会运行),然后再安装新的程序,以免被覆盖或截断。 不幸的是,最近一个应用程序在安装后崩溃。 巧合? 很难说。 这里真正的解决scheme是切换到一个更老的安装方法,而不是一个旧的巨大的shell脚本,但它会很高兴有一些额外的保护,直到开关制成。 有没有什么方法来包装一个shell脚本,以防止覆盖或截断文件(理想情况下大声失败),但仍然允许他们移动或rm'd? 标准的UNIX文件权限不会执行这个技巧,因为你无法区分移动/删除和覆盖/截断。 别名可以工作,但我不知道什么样的命令需要别名。 我想像truss / strace之类的东西,除非在每个动作之前检查filter是否真正做到这一点。 我不需要一个完美的解决scheme,甚至可以对付有意识的恶意脚本。 我到目前为止的想法是: 别名cp到GNU cp(因为我在Solaris上不是默认的)并使用–remove-destination选项。 别名安装到GNU安装并使用–backup选项。 将现有文件移动到备份文件名称可能非常聪明,而不是复制,从而保留了inode。 在〜/ .bashrc中设置“noclobber”,以便I / Oredirect不会覆盖文件

我可以设置一个testing服务器,然后将所有内容传输到diff中。 生产服务器?

我将要build立一个“真正的”服务器,但它不会再运送一周。 我打算使用一台额外的工作站来设置服务器的大部分function。 我想在这台普通机器上设置Windows Server 2003或2008,IIS,terminal服务,防火墙和防病毒软件。 我也会安装Winzip和VMWare等服务器上使用的软件。 我不能鬼机,就像我以前所做的一样,因为主板/ CPU /等。 都会有所不同 有没有办法导出所有的“服务器设置”或类似的东西,所以我可以移动从testing到生产的一切? 有没有什么软件可以做类似的事情? 有些东西,我将不得不等待,如设置文件服务器完全在其RAIDconfiguration,但我想要简单的服务器的东西和networking设置的方式。 有没有人做过这个? 我需要开源还是不开源软件? 或者也许有办法以某种方式导出所有的服务器设置? 提前致谢! 贾斯汀